What’s the cheapest day of the week to fly from Ahmedabad to Austin?

The average price of all flights from Ahmedabad to Austin clicked on KAYAK for each day over the last 12 months.
Your flight ticket price will generally be cheaper if you fly to Austin on a Saturday and more expensive on a Sunday. On your return trip to Ahmedabad, you should consider flying back on a Tuesday, and avoid Fridays for better deals.

What is the cheapest month to fly from Ahmedabad to Austin?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for flights from Ahmedabad to Austin,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.
The cheapest month for flights from Ahmedabad to Austin is November, where tickets cost $1,448 on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are August and December, where the average cost of tickets is $2,364 and $1,971 respectively.

How far in advance should I book a flight from Ahmedabad to Austin?

To calculate daily average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each day before departure over the last year for flights from Ahmedabad to Austin,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the average of all the values for each month.
To get a below average price on the flight from Ahmedabad to Austin, you should book around 2 weeks before departure. For the absolute cheapest price, our data suggests you should book 68 days before departure.

  • What is the Hacker Fare option on flights from Ahmedabad to Austin?

    Hacker Fares allow you to combine one-way tickets in order to save you money over a traditional round-trip ticket. You could then fly to Austin with an airline and back to Ahmedabad with another airline. Booking your flights between Ahmedabad and AUS can sometimes prove cheaper using this method.
